Law360 details the biggest noncompete developments of 2018, including The Nuvasive decision, which automatically nullifies non-California venue provisions in employment contracts except when the covered worker was “represented by legal counsel” when they negotiated the deal. In the article, Morgan Lewis partner Debra Fischer says California passed the law to “be protective over employees who had no negotiating power” and cut back on courts’ discretion over venue disputes. “It is not at all clear that the California legislature, by enacting this law, intended to allow employees, simply because they are represented by counsel, to waive fundamental rights they have as California residents, including freedom from post-employment covenants not to compete,” Fischer says.
